This is a newly-created Senior Management Accountant role with a leading UK Building and Construction Business. This role offers a platform to grow into a managerial position and progress within the close-knit finance team in their London Office.

The Role

This is a newly created Senior Management Accountant role in their London office and key responsibilities will include:

  • Overseeing the delivery of Management Accounts for a portfolio of projects - Multiset Management Accounts
  • Preparation of Budgets, Analysis and Commentary for Finance Business Partners
  • Mentoring of Juniors - develop team to drive productivity and act as lead on further recruitment processes where needed
  • Ad Hoc Improvements - identify process improvements and assist with implementations
  • Profile

    What's Needed

  • Qualified ACA or ACCA
  • Strong management accounts background
  • Line management exposure desirable
  • Highly developed interpersonal skills - ongoing development of effective working relationships to help drive team performance
  • Proactive with a proven ability to perform under pressure
